在主板设计中,如何通过LPC接口与Super I/O芯片集成,来兼容并支持传统I/O设备,同时实现成本效益?
时间: 2024-10-26 19:07:01 浏览: 34
实现LPC接口与Super I/O芯片的集成,首先需要理解LPC接口的工作原理及其在硬件设计中的应用。LPC(Low Pin Count)接口是一种简化了的I/O总线,用于连接系统主板上的低速外设,如串行端口、并行端口、键盘和鼠标等。Super I/O芯片则是管理这些低速设备的集成控制器。将LPC接口与Super I/O芯片集成,关键在于以下几个步骤:
参考资源链接:[英特尔LPC接口规范:简化传统I/O过渡](https://wenku.csdn.net/doc/6401ac03cce7214c316ea4fa?spm=1055.2569.3001.10343)
1. 设计电路时,首先确保LPC接口的物理连接正确,包括数据线、地址线和控制线等,与Super I/O芯片的相应引脚相连。
2. 配置LPC接口的寄存器,以匹配Super I/O芯片所需的通信协议,这通常包括中断请求(IRQ)、直接内存访问(DMA)和I/O地址映射等。
3. 为保持软件兼容性,需要确保LPC接口在操作系统中表现为旧ISA设备的等效设备,这就需要编写或修改设备驱动程序,以便操作系统能够通过LPC总线正确识别和管理Super I/O芯片。
4. 测试集成后的系统,验证所有传统I/O设备是否能够正常工作,包括内存交易和DMA操作是否符合预期。
5. 关注LPC接口规范中的保留和未定义特性,避免在设计中依赖这些特征,以免将来升级或变更时造成兼容性问题。
通过以上步骤,可以确保Super I/O芯片通过LPC接口集成到主板设计中,从而有效支持传统I/O设备,并与现有软件保持兼容性,同时实现成本效益。这一集成过程将有助于简化硬件设计,降低制造成本,并加速行业从ISA总线向更高效的LPC接口过渡。
为了更深入地理解这一过程,推荐阅读《英特尔LPC接口规范:简化传统I/O过渡》,这本资料详细介绍了LPC接口的设计原则、电气特性以及实现软硬件兼容性的策略,对于希望深入了解并实践LPC接口设计的工程师和技术人员来说,是宝贵的学习资源。
参考资源链接:[英特尔LPC接口规范:简化传统I/O过渡](https://wenku.csdn.net/doc/6401ac03cce7214c316ea4fa?spm=1055.2569.3001.10343)
阅读全文